**Practical Tips for Maximizing Your Budget:**

1. Research and Plan Ahead:
– Research your destination to understand the local costs and average expenses. This will help you set a realistic budget.
– Plan your itinerary in advance to avoid last-minute expensive bookings.
– Take advantage of shoulder seasons or off-peak times when prices tend to be lower.

2. Save on Accommodation:
– Consider alternative accommodations like vacation rentals, hostels, or bed and breakfasts, which can be more budget-friendly than hotels.
– Use online booking platforms and compare prices to find the best deals.
– Join loyalty programs or hotel membership programs to benefit from exclusive discounts and perks.

3. Optimize Transportation Costs:
– Compare flight prices using search engines or online travel agencies.
– Be flexible with your travel dates and opt for weekdays, as they tend to be cheaper than weekends.
– Use public transportation or walk whenever possible to save money on taxis or rental cars.
– Research local transportation passes or cards that offer unlimited travel within a specified duration.

4. Enjoy Local Cuisine on a Budget:
– Explore local food markets and street vendors to indulge in authentic cuisine at affordable prices.
– Avoid touristy restaurants near popular attractions, as they often have inflated prices.
– Research popular inexpensive local dishes to make informed choices.

**How to Get the Best Currency Exchange Rates:**

1. Monitor Exchange Rates:
– Stay updated with the currency exchange rates of your destination by using reliable online tools or currency conversion apps.
– Consider monitoring rates over a period of time to identify any trends or favorable times to exchange.

2. Exchange Money in Advance:
– Avoid exchanging currency at airports or tourist hubs, as they often charge higher fees and provide less favorable rates.
– Exchange a small amount of the local currency in your home country for immediate expenses upon arrival.
– Look for currency exchange providers that offer competitive rates and low fees.

3. Use Local ATMs:
– Withdrawing cash from local ATMs using your debit or credit card can often provide better rates than exchanging physical currency.
– Be aware of any fees your bank may charge for international ATM transactions and compare them with other currency exchange options.
